比如我想开发一个小软件,电脑定时自动关机,那,怎样 分析有哪个类??设计出来哪那个类?谢谢。

解决方案 »

  1.   


    System.Diagnostics.Process.Start("Shutdown", "-s -t 10");
      

  2.   

    楼主是想了解一下OO,所以提了个小问题,大家都误会了我对OO也不是非常了解,只能尽力回答了 CLASS 电脑
       电脑名
       电脑开机时间
       电脑关机时间 CLASS 关机
       关机时间() VOID 执行
      IF (电脑开机 = TRUE)
       关机时间(电脑名);OO就是要有 继承,递归,多变的原则个人意见,如有错误,请见谅 
      

  3.   


    需要纠正几点: OO还必须 CLASS 电脑
    {
    电脑名
    bool 电脑状态   
    电脑开机时间
    电脑关机时间
    关机()
    工作()
    }关机这个动作 应该是 电脑 的行为。没必要单独作类。如果一定要做一个关机类,可以做一个 批量关机类(){}
    传入n个电脑实例,然后遍历调用 各个实例的关机行为
      

  4.   

    class 电脑
       名字
       关机();class 电脑管理员
       关机(电脑)
       执行计划()class 关机计划
       电脑
       关机时间.........
      

  5.   

    标题一开始还没想到是OOP呢
    我还以为要和QQ对着干,取名OO的聊天软件咯